I will recheck the fuses. Also I have a symptom I didn't mention before. The cabin dome light will not activate when the doors are open, but will work manually by setting the dash board brightness to max.
Well it appears to be a door switch issue. I could hear a humming coming from the switch when it was engaged, which was a huge give-away. Took off the switch and removed the housing. It has some white stuff reminiscent or mold (but not actually mold, more like oxidation from a short) around the solder where the wiring harness feeds into the prongs. I am hoping this is the culprit.
